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Black Howler Monkey | Yarkand Hare |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class same | Mammalia (Mammals)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Primates (Primates) | Lagomorpha (Rabbits & Hares) |
| Family | Atelidae | Leporidae (Rabbits & Hares) |
| Genus | Alouatta | Lepus |
| Species | Alouatta pigra | Lepus yarkandensis |
Evolutionary Relationship
Black Howler Monkey and Yarkand Hare share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(Mammals)
